1. Understanding Your Target Audience
Before diving into marketing strategies‚ it is crucial to identify and understand your target audience. In the realm of real estate photography‚ your primary clients may include:
- Real Estate Agents: Professionals who need high-quality images to market properties.
- Property Developers: Individuals or companies looking to showcase new developments.
- Homeowners: People selling their properties who want to present them in the best light.
- Investors: Individuals seeking to purchase properties and require visual documentation.
By understanding the needs and preferences of these groups‚ you can tailor your marketing efforts more effectively.
2. Building a Strong Portfolio
Your portfolio is your most vital marketing tool. It serves as a visual resume that showcases your skills and style. Here are some tips to create a compelling portfolio:
- Quality Over Quantity: Select your best work‚ focusing on a diverse range of properties and styles.
- Highlight Your Unique Style: Make sure your portfolio reflects your signature style‚ whether it’s modern‚ traditional‚ or avant-garde.
- Include Before-and-After Shots: Demonstrating your editing skills can be a powerful way to convince potential clients of your expertise.
- Use a Professional Website: Your portfolio should be hosted on a clean‚ user-friendly website that is optimized for mobile devices.

4. Networking with Real Estate Professionals
Building connections within the real estate industry can significantly enhance your client base. Here are some networking strategies:
- Attend Industry Events: Participate in real estate expos‚ conferences‚ and seminars to meet potential clients.
- Join Local Real Estate Groups: Engage with local real estate associations or groups to connect with agents and developers.
- Collaborate with Real Estate Agents: Offer to partner with agents for listings and open houses‚ providing them with high-quality images in exchange for referrals;
5. Utilizing Online Advertising
Online advertising can greatly expand your reach. Consider the following options:
- Google Ads: Create targeted ads that appear when potential clients search for real estate photography services.
- Facebook Ads: Use Facebook’s targeting capabilities to reach specific demographics interested in real estate.
- Retargeting Campaigns: Implement retargeting ads to reach visitors who have previously engaged with your website or social media.
6. Offering Packages and Promotions
To attract more clients‚ consider offering various packages and promotional deals:
- Tiered Packages: Offer different service levels (basic‚ standard‚ premium) to cater to various budgets.
- Seasonal Promotions: Create special offers during peak real estate seasons or holidays.
- Referral Discounts: Encourage satisfied clients to refer others by providing discounts on future services;
